CUI前端框架,全称是Component-Based User Interface框架,是一种基于组件化开发的前端框架。它旨在帮助开发者快速构建具有高性能和响应式设计的现代网页。本文将深入探讨CUI前端框架的特点、优势以及如何高效使用它。
一、CUI前端框架概述
1.1 定义
CUI前端框架是一种以组件为中心的开发模式,通过将页面拆分为多个可复用的组件,使得开发者可以专注于单个组件的开发,从而提高开发效率和代码质量。
1.2 特点
- 组件化:将页面拆分为多个独立的组件,便于管理和复用。
- 响应式设计:支持不同设备屏幕尺寸的适配,提供一致的用户体验。
- 模块化:采用模块化设计,便于代码组织和维护。
- 高性能:通过优化渲染性能,提升用户体验。
二、CUI前端框架的优势
2.1 提高开发效率
CUI前端框架将页面拆分为多个组件,开发者只需关注单个组件的开发,减少了重复劳动,提高了开发效率。
2.2 代码复用
组件化的设计使得开发者可以将常用组件在不同页面中复用,降低了代码冗余。
2.3 易于维护
模块化的设计使得代码结构清晰,便于维护和扩展。
2.4 良好的用户体验
响应式设计使得网页在不同设备上都能提供良好的视觉效果和交互体验。
三、CUI前端框架的应用
3.1 组件库
CUI前端框架通常提供丰富的组件库,包括按钮、表单、导航栏、模态框等,开发者可以根据需求选择合适的组件。
3.2 开发流程
- 需求分析:根据项目需求,确定所需的组件和功能。
- 组件开发:根据需求开发所需组件,并进行单元测试。
- 页面构建:将组件组合成页面,并进行整体测试。
- 优化与部署:对页面进行性能优化,并部署上线。
3.3 示例代码
以下是一个使用CUI前端框架的简单示例:
<!-- 引入CUI前端框架样式 -->
<link rel="stylesheet" href="cui.css">
<!-- 使用CUI组件 -->
<div class="cui-container">
<div class="cui-header">
<h1>欢迎来到我的网站</h1>
</div>
<div class="cui-body">
<p>这是一个使用CUI前端框架构建的页面。</p>
</div>
<div class="cui-footer">
<p>版权所有 © 2023</p>
</div>
</div>
四、总结
CUI前端框架作为一种高效、易用的前端框架,能够帮助开发者轻松驾驭现代网页设计。通过组件化、响应式设计等特性,CUI前端框架在提高开发效率、降低代码冗余、优化用户体验等方面具有显著优势。对于想要快速构建现代网页的开发者来说,CUI前端框架是一个不错的选择。
